Output 221587665a722e9a71ff7c15b1289db9f41f2a7ca2b828ff6fc27dd258a407ad:5

value
50204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f9cff61e89fb70b39c510b5649f180b7a27d51 OP_EQUAL
address
3Dp8P8bFQc5qaDzDWHJBururhqUkAZaypb
transaction
221587665a722e9a71ff7c15b1289db9f41f2a7ca2b828ff6fc27dd258a407ad
spent
false